Day by day itinerary
Expand all days
Day 1
See more
Explore Bishkek and Travel to Kochkor

Upon your arrival in Bishkek International airport early in the morning, you will meet with your guide and transfer to the hotel. Take some time to rest and enjoy breakfast in the hotel, before heading out on a walking excursion in the city. Here you will visit the main locations in the center, such as Oak Park, Central Square, and the National Museum. Enjoy lunch in a local restaurant, before transferring to Kochkor, where you will visit a felt carpet workshop where local women produce traditional Kyrgyz carpets – shyrdak and ala-kiiz. Accommodation and dinner in a hotel in Kochkor.

Day 2
See more
Cycle to Kyzyl-Tuu Village

Today will begin with a transfer to Kara-Talaa – a small village on the southern shore of Issyk-Kul Lake (70 km, 1,5 hours of driving). From here you will start cycling along the Tuura-Suu River for around 20 km, which will bring you to Ala-Bash Pass (2370 m). After crossing the pass, you will enter the so-called “Second Valley” – Valley of Ala-Bash.

Ride down to Kara-Koo Village for around 30 km and continue on the main road for a few kilometers to reach Kyzyl-Tuu village. After a short rest, you will visit the famous workshops where local craftsmen produce wooden goods and will be glad to present them to you. Traditional dinner and overnight stay in the village.

Day 3
See more
Konur-Olen Valley and Eagle Hunting Show

Cycling up from Kara-Koo village, you will travel along Dubana gorge to the Konur-Olen Valley. This valley is known for its many small creeks and swamps. Continue to Kok-Say Village where you will find the Jaichi yurt camp., your accommodations for the night. Later on in the day, you will enjoy a unique performance – an eagle hunting show, where you can learn about traditional hunting techniques and history. Dinner and overnight in yurt camp.

Day 4
See more
Cycle along Issyk-Kul Lake

Today you will continue along the Konur-Olen Valley and descend to Bokonbaevo village. While cycling, you will have the opportunity to see life in a remote Kyrgyz village. From here, the route goes to Issyk-Kul Lake and the Almaluu yurt camp. Dinner and overnight in yurt camp.

Day 5
See more
Ride along the Ak-Terek River

Returning along the shoreline of Issyk-Kul Lake, you will head toward the Tegerek mountains and ride along the Ak-Terek River. Flower fields along the road add some nice scenery to your journey under the hot sun. After crossing a pass at 2540 m, you will arrive at the Boz-Salkyn yurt camp. Dinner and overnight in yurt camp.

Day 7
See more
Skazka Canyon and Folklore Performance in Bishkek

The last leg of your trip will bring you back to Bishkek by means of a car transfer (320 km), stopping along the way to walk in the Skazka Canyons. In the evening, you will enjoy dinner in a local restaurant, where you will also experience a folklore performance with traditional Kyrgyz songs, musical instruments, and get acquainted with the history of Kyrgyz music. Can I rent a bike?

Yes, you can rent a bike during the booking process. Rental bikes are of medium class with hardtails, aluminum frame, Shimano-Deore or SRAM X4/5 level of equipment, hydraulic disk brakes, and spring front fork.
